alexmyczko avatar alexmyczko commented on July 17, 2024

as you can see in https://github.com/oguzhaninan/Stacer/blob/native/stacer/static.qrc the theme and font is embedded into the build thus it is a build time option. not ine you can change during runtime.

alexmyczko avatar alexmyczko commented on July 17, 2024

well you could say apt-get source stacer, do your changes, debuild and install your new .deb?
